
On September 10th 12pm UTC, CESS (Cumulus Encrypted Storage System) held an AMA with the PolkaWarriors community to introduce the project and answer community members’ questions about topics related to data cloud storage networks, decentralized data storage, etc.
CESS is a decentralized cloud storage network for data storing and sharing. CESS is an open-source, public blockchain intended to be the underlying network infrastructure for decentralized storage needs.
As an open-source public blockchain, CESS securely provides a high-speed and high-throughput storage system widely applicable to enterprises and projects for both Web2 and Web3.
CESS is a full-stack solution built on Substrate (a blockchain SDK framework). CESS supports use cases like Metaverse, NFT, DeFi, and streaming media.

1. What problems is CESS solving, and what are the advantages between CESS and other projects?
Molly: Data security, privacy and data rights ownership are the major issues affecting traditional data cloud storage. For decentralized data storage, the most significant drawbacks are slow data return and network usability. Some projects even experience data loss.
Commercial applications require more data services and powerful performance. CESS ensures data integrity through multi-copy technology and a complete data storage scheme, making data loss that often occurred in IPFS almost impossible.
IPFS’s another common problem is slow data retrieval which does not meet the commercial requirement. CESS innovatively resolved it by assigning two additional miner types, a total of four types of miners to perform the work separately for fast indexing, discovery, and returning data. CESS’s data return speed is measured in milliseconds while other projects take minutes and even hours downloading data. In addition, CESS storage can ensure 99.99% data availability, and plus unlimited network scalability.
CESS’s consensus mechanism solves “Farmer’s Dilemma”, encouraging open and fair participation in a stable and efficient network with clear rewards and punishments scheme. 3. How is CESS planning to attract users and show that CESS is a tool with better underlying technology and easier, more intuitive development experience? What are the challenges you are trying to solve in the next 6–12 months ?
Molly: We have been building close relationships not only with Polkadot but also with the projects in the ecosystem. To get our first very own and stable clients, we will help offer our storage and data services to all the projects to the Polkdadot communites.
Since CESS is built with Substrate (a SDK- software development kit ), There many other Substrate-based projects currently. CESS is in the process of designing a storage pallet to help developers integrate CESS’s storage services directly into their Substrate-based projects without major code modifications. This pallet will greatly improve the convenience for all Substrate projects to use secure decentralized storage services provided by CESS, synergizing the development of both Substrate and CESS’s ecosystems.

2. Can you explain how your Tokenomics are distributed? How many tokens will be minted? And how many tokens will be locked by the pool?
Molly: Total 10 billion CESS tokens
55% Miners, linear rating, halved every 4 years
15% Initial Contributors, 6 years linear review
10% Community / DAO / incentive and advertising
10% funding for future development
5% Cooperation Partner, DAO
5% for emergency use and future ecosystem development
CESS incentivizes network contributors/miners and community members fairly in order to build an efficient data storage network. There are four types of miners in the CESS network: storage capacity miners, consensus miners, cache miners, and retrieval miners. Miner rewards are calculated fairly and meticulously, and are proportional to storage space, computational power and other runtime factors.
